Parts

If the ignition switch in your vehicle isn't working correctly, you'll have to replace both the switch as as the lock cylinder. Locksmiths will disassemble the old switch and lock cylinder, then remove the lock cylinder pins (if they have not been removed) and then install the new cylinder with all the necessary key-specific hardware. The locksmith will make use of a blank ignition key to test the new ignition to ensure it's working correctly.

Ignition switch problems are more common than many people realize and can be costly if you don't address them promptly. This is particularly true in modern cars, which have numerous electronic components, including the ignition system.

An experienced locksmith is able to identify and fix ignition issues immediately, avoiding you the trouble of finding an expert mechanic or wait for an appointment at the dealership service center. They can also offer a more affordable option than purchasing a new set of keys from a dealer.

If your car is equipped with traditional metal key shafts or a transponder chips that communicates with your car's immobilizer, an experienced locksmith can repair your ignition at a reasonable cost. If you don't possess an additional key or immobilizer code or key number that the locksmith would need to obtain from the manufacturer or dealer, the cost may be higher.

The ignition switch is among the lighter parts of your car's ignition and is more prone to failure. The switch is not as costly as an ignition cylinder to replace, however you might still need to pay a significant amount if you want a new key or need to repair the switch. The locksmith will remove the cover for the steering column and disconnect the battery prior to removing any screws that may be blocking the ignition switch.

A technician will replace the switch and reconnect the electrical connectors. They will also take out any components that could interfere with the airbags. They will then test the new ignition, by connecting the battery to the car and turning the key from ON to START position.

Labor

If you have trouble turning your key into the ignition and key replacement, it could be an indication that your ignition switch is malfunctioning. The ignition switch transmits electrical energy to your spark plugs, allowing them to ignite and start your engine. Over time your ignition switch will wear out. It is crucial to replace it as soon as possible as, without a functioning ignition switch, your vehicle will not start.

A locksmith is a trained professional in automotive locksmithing. They can install an ignition switch replacement for you, and have the tools required to do it right. They can also assist with other car issues like a damaged ignition key or insecure electronic lock systems.

The cost of an ignition cylinder is determined by the kind of vehicle, as well as the type of key it is using. Most locksmiths charge about $100 for a basic key, but it can be more expensive for more advanced keys with security chips. It is best to leave this task to a professional since it can be dangerous to attempt at home.

Many people call an auto locksmith when they are experiencing problems with their ignition cylinders. They can identify the problem and fix it quickly. These professionals have the expertise and experience to complete the job right, which will save you money over the course of time. They will also ensure that the replacement is a good fit for your vehicle.

Keep your ignition system running well by replacing the worn spark plugs as well as lubricating the lock and key cylinder. Additionally, you must inspect and clean the battery connections and terminals and the high-tension leads. It is also beneficial to change the oil regularly.

Diagnostics

Many people are shocked to find out that they can hire locksmiths to do the job on their vehicle at a fraction of the price it would cost at a car dealership. That's because most of the time that a car is having ignition problems it's not due to the switch, but because something was wrong with the vehicle's ignition lock cylinder or its related wiring. A locksmith can identify the problem and fix car ignition it fast.

The ignition cylinder issues usually begin due to wear and tear. The van ignition repair key is repeatedly turned over the life of an automobile, and this can cause it to have issues. Furthermore, if you are using an overly heavy and bulky keychain, it can cause extra friction in the ignition, which can cause issues.

The ignition switch and the ignition coil are simple to remove and change. A locksmith will usually have to remove the plastic covers for the steering wheel and then take apart the ignition to access the parts. They can then replace the switch, install a new lock cylinder, and then reinstall the other components that were removed to make the repair ignition lock cylinder.

If the issue is with the ignition wires, it could take longer as they will need to be replaced too. They're not expensive however, they are easier to replace than the switch itself.

Installation

It can be a hassle to find an ignition switch that does not work. If it fails to start your car it could mean you are having to pay for a costly tow or dealership service. Locksmiths can help you find an immediate solution.

The issue with an ignition is often due to the physical wear and tear of the parts within. A heavy keychain can create pressure on the ignition when it is inserted. This can cause rust and wear down of the tumblers that regulate the ignition lock repair coil. Extreme temperature fluctuations can affect the lubricants and materials that make up the switch. In any case it is recommended to seek the services of a professional that can thoroughly examine and replace the ignition switch in your car.

A professional automotive locksmith is equipped with the knowledge, tools and equipment required to complete this task in a safe and speedy way. Most often, they can replace the ignition switch without needing to disassemble the steering column. In the majority of cases, a locksmith can replace the ignition switch within a matter of minutes. They can also replace the ignition lock cylinder if needed, and always ensure that all electrical connections are correct and functioning.
